In the US, voted for tax cuts

Фото: Depositphotos

The Republican-controlled House of Representatives on Thursday took an important step toward tax reform, voting in favor of tax cuts for corporations and individuals.

Earlier on Thursday, on the eve of the vote, President Trump once again called for a large-scale tax law reform and met with Republicans from the House of Representatives, writes "Voice of America".

Before the vote, legislators were addressed by Speaker of the House of Representatives Paul Ryan, who called tax reform "the biggest historical matter we will do."

Republican leaders are optimistic about their chances of gaining enough votes to pass a bill providing for reduction tax for corporations with 35%, one of the highest rates in the world, to 20%, as well as tax cuts for millions of middle-class tax payers, but not for the entire population. This initiative will increase the country's long-term debt, amounting to 20 trillions of dollars, by another 1,5 trillion.

As a result, 227 votes were cast for changing the tax plan, and 205 were against.

Trump, for the 10 months in office, never won a single major legislative victory, She urged Congress to hold a tax reform for Christmas. However, the proposed changes cause mixed reviews, and none of the Democrats did not support the initiative.

The leaders of the Republicans in the Senate are promoting their own tax plan, but his fate remains uncertain, since the Republicans have a majority of only four votes. Senator Ron Johnson from Wisconsin on Wednesday became the first Republican senator to speak out against both versions of the bill, saying that they are not cutting enough taxes for small businesses.

Democrats oppose Republican attempts to cut taxes, insisting that it will be beneficial to the richest taxpayers, but will not help those who earn much less. The changes under consideration will affect almost all taxpayers, but so far the outlines of the initiative are so vague that many cannot figure out whether taxes will become lower for them.

Trump tweeted: "Tax cuts are nearing!"

At the same time, he criticized the Democrats for not supporting the initiative, curling: “Why do democrats struggle with large-scale tax cuts for the middle class and business (jobs)? Reason: sabotage and delay! ”.

One of the leaders of the Republicans in the House of Representatives, Congressman Kevin Brady, said that the plan in question "represents a bold way that will allow us as a nation to break out of the stage of slow growth once and for all."

Trump also complicated the adoption of tax reform by asking Congress to include in the bill a clause that eliminates the mandatory requirement for health insurance. Earlier this year, Congress had already failed to reform the program. Obamacareadopted by ex-President Barack Obama.

Democrats and some Republicans oppose the inclusion of this provision in the tax bill, and if it remains in the text, it may reduce the chances of success of the tax initiative, especially in the Senate.

During his Asia tour, Trump tweeted: “I'm proud of the (Republican) House and Senate for working so hard on tax cuts (and reform). We are getting closer to the goal! Now how about ending the unfair and deeply unpopular OCare requirement and cutting taxes even further?
